Towson, Maryland3 days ago With an average length of stay between 10 and 14 days, the Thought Disorders Unit is unique as it is one of the few specialized units across the country that specifically cares for patients with psychotic illnesses. The Thought Disorders Unit is a 22-bed unit that treats patients with psychotic illnesses, including Schizophrenia, Schizoaffective Disorder, Bipolar Disorders, as well as Neuropsychiatric Disorders.
